Commit c8e94936 authored by 王品堯's avatar 王品堯

調整metadata的轉換

parent 7079ab03
...@@ -151,15 +151,9 @@ ...@@ -151,15 +151,9 @@
NSString *uuid = bloodPressureSystolicValue.UUID.UUIDString; NSString *uuid = bloodPressureSystolicValue.UUID.UUIDString;
NSError *error; NSString *metadata = [bloodPressureSystolicValue.metadata == nil ? @"" : bloodPressureSystolicValue.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(bloodPressureSystolicValue.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= bloodPressureSystolicValue.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"bloodPressureSystolicValue" : @([bloodPressureSystolicValue.quantity doubleValueForUnit:unit]), @"bloodPressureSystolicValue" : @([bloodPressureSystolicValue.quantity doubleValueForUnit:unit]),
...@@ -232,15 +226,9 @@ ...@@ -232,15 +226,9 @@
NSString *uuid = bloodPressureValues.UUID.UUIDString; NSString *uuid = bloodPressureValues.UUID.UUIDString;
NSError *error; NSString *metadata = [bloodPressureSystolicValue.metadata == nil ? @"" : bloodPressureSystolicValue.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(bloodPressureSystolicValue.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= bloodPressureSystolicValue.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"bloodPressureSystolicValue" : @([bloodPressureSystolicValue.quantity doubleValueForUnit:unit]), @"bloodPressureSystolicValue" : @([bloodPressureSystolicValue.quantity doubleValueForUnit:unit]),
......
...@@ -92,15 +92,9 @@ ...@@ -92,15 +92,9 @@
NSString *uuid = sample.UUID.UUIDString; NSString *uuid = sample.UUID.UUIDString;
NSError *error; NSString *metadata = [sample.metadata == nil ? @"" : sample.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(sample.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= sample.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"value" : @(value), @"value" : @(value),
...@@ -202,15 +196,9 @@ ...@@ -202,15 +196,9 @@
NSString *uuid = sample.UUID.UUIDString; NSString *uuid = sample.UUID.UUIDString;
NSError *error; NSString *metadata = [sample.metadata == nil ? @"" : sample.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(sample.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= sample.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"value" : valueString, @"value" : valueString,
...@@ -540,15 +528,9 @@ ...@@ -540,15 +528,9 @@
NSString *uuid = sample.UUID.UUIDString; NSString *uuid = sample.UUID.UUIDString;
NSError *error; NSString *metadata = [sample.metadata == nil ? @"" : sample.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(sample.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= sample.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"value" : @(value), @"value" : @(value),
...@@ -698,15 +680,9 @@ ...@@ -698,15 +680,9 @@
NSString *uuid = sample.UUID.UUIDString; NSString *uuid = sample.UUID.UUIDString;
NSError *error; NSString *metadata = [sample.metadata == nil ? @"" : sample.metadata.description stringByReplacingOccurrencesOfString:@" " withString:@""];
NSDictionary *metaDict; metadata = [metadata stringByReplacingOccurrencesOfString:@"\r" withString:@""];
if(sample.metadata == nil){ metadata = [metadata stringByReplacingOccurrencesOfString:@"\n" withString:@""];
metaDict = [[NSDictionary alloc] init];
}else{
metaDict = sample.metadata;
}
NSData *jsonData = [NSJSONSerialization dataWithJSONObject:metaDict options:NSJSONWritingPrettyPrinted error:&error];
NSString *metadata =[[NSString alloc] initWithData:jsonData encoding:NSUTF8StringEncoding];
NSDictionary *elem = @{ NSDictionary *elem = @{
@"value" : valueString, @"value" : valueString,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ment